Focus Areas

Urology covers a wide range of medical specialties that deal with the urinary tract of both men and women, as well as the male reproductive organs
Our practice focuses on surgical urology, with Dr. med. Seiler leading the field with his many years of experience and expertise. Thanks to state-of-the-art techniques, including robot-assisted surgery, we offer precise and minimally invasive procedures, particularly in the areas of prostate, kidney and bladder surgery, as well as the treatment of urological tumors.

Prostate: As men age, the risk of prostate diseases increases. We therefore recommend regular preventive check-ups for men aged 40 to 45 to detect potential changes early and provide appropriate treatment.

Kidneys and Ureters: Our expertise includes the diagnosis and treatment of kidney and ureter diseases, such as kidney stones, infections, and tumors. We rely on state-of-the-art diagnostic methods and individually tailored treatment concepts.

Bladder and Urethra: We treat a wide range of bladder and urethral conditions, including incontinence, infections, and tumors, with the goal of improving our patients' quality of life.

Male Genital Organs: Our practice offers comprehensive diagnostics and treatment for diseases affecting the male reproductive organs, including erectile dysfunction, infections, and tumors.

Female-Specific Urology: We also address urological concerns specific to women, such as urinary incontinence, bladder infections, and other functional disorders, offering customized treatment solutions.
